Can You Get Married Without a Ceremony in BC? | Vancity Officiant Wedding Guide
Many couples wonder if they can get legally married without a ceremony in British Columbia. While weddings can be very simple, BC law still requires a legal ceremony conducted by an authorized officiant with two witnesses present. Here is how the process actually works.

What Does It Mean to Be an Ordained Wedding Officiant in BC? | Vancity Officiant Wedding Guide
In British Columbia, a wedding ceremony is not just symbolic, it is a legal act. Only authorized officiants can solemnize a marriage, and the officiant who signs the marriage registration must be present to conduct and witness the ceremony. This guide explains how wedding officiants are authorized in BC and what couples should know before choosing one.
